Agent Description

Auction Location: In-rooms – Level 1, 33 Lytton Rd, East Brisbane. With excellent street appeal and a large grassed yard, this lovely four-bedroom Queenslander is full of potential. Ideal for families and investors, this elevated traditional timber build has been thoughtfully updated to suit modern living. Situated in a tranquil Norman Park pocket, the property flows from its elegant entrance to an open-plan living and dining area with air-conditioning. An adjoining kitchen comes complete with touches like a near-new oven and cooktop and ample benchspace and cabinetry storage. Another notable highlight is the recently renovated bathroom, with shuttered windows, a floating vanity and a fresh white colour palette. Completing the home's interior are four sizeable bedrooms, two with built-in robes, while ceiling fans feature throughout the home. Outside, a north-facing covered deck is accessible through the living area's classic French doors. Perfect for entertaining, it looks out over the fully-fenced rear lawn. There is also a garden shed and a well-planted garden. Close to beautiful parklands and a number of fantastic dining options, this marvellous home is also minutes from the Norman Park Ferry Terminal. Catch the ferry over the river to beloved New Farm Park, or enjoy a scenic trip into the city. Falling within the Norman Park State School catchment area, the property is also a short distance from the prestigious Lourdes Hill College and Churchie.
